#7a4436 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7a4436 is composed of 47.8% red, 26.7%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.3% magenta, 55.7% yellow and 52.2% black. It has a hue angle of 12.4 degrees, a saturation of 38.6% and a lightness of 34.5%. #7a4436 color hex could be obtained by blending #f4886c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#7a4436

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0706 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#7a4436

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#585858 is the less saturated color, while #a92807 is the most saturated one.
